When Rest Of The World Sleeps, India Awakes, Supreme Court Gets Underway.

Under some very unprecedented circumstances, the supreme court of India gets underway at 02.30A.M on Thrusday 30th july 2015, just to hear the last minute legal petition of the counsel for Yaqub Memon to seek a 14 day repreieve after the rejection of his mercy plea by the president.

Well, whatever be the legal points that were discussed during the hearing,  this is what needs to be commended.

Something which makes every Indian to feel proud about the judicial system of the country.

After the accused uses all possible resources in order to evade the death sentence, the Supreme court just before a few hours of the hanging, sits in the supreme court premises to hear the last moment plea of the accused’s counsel during wee hours.

Though the plea is dismissed on legal grounds, but what needs to be applauded is the landmark hearing in the most unprecedented and unusual circumstances, just to give the accused the last chance to defend himself.

The defence counsel perhaps knew that they are defending the indefensible, but they moved the highest court of the country and the case was heard, thereby setting an extraordinary example of legal jurisprudence, which, we as Indians should really be proud of.

Although this court hearing is not something to celebrate, because it was something which was related to the death of a human being.

But at the same time it was something which related to the justice to be meted to  the families of those 257 human beings who lost their precious lives in the bomb blasts. And also the families of  about 100 victims who got injured in the dastardly and barbaric bomb blast.
